The volume of sales required must be sufficient to earn a contribution that covers the fixed costs and make the target amount of profit i,e the contribution needed to earn the target profit is target profit PLUS the fixed costs. The unit sales required to attain the target profit can be estimated by dividing the sum of the target profit and fixed expense by the unit contribution margin. In target pricing, the selling price for a product is determined first.Based on the insights from the marketing department and other market intelligence data, the most competitive price that the customers would be willing to pay is fixed as a selling price.. If one wants to know the dollar level of sales to achieve a target net income: Sales to Achieve a Target Income = (Total Fixed Costs + Target Income) / Contribution Margin Ratio $3,000,000 = $1,800,000 / 0.60 A small, inflatable toy has come onto the market that the company is anxious to produce and sell. Part A: Changes in Fixed and Variable Costs; Break-Even and Target. Dollar sales to attain target profit = (Fixed expenses + Target profit) / Contribution margin ratio.
